Today I was at a local international grocery, and they were selling the variety of banana pictured below. The sign said that they were "Thi Bananas." I don't know whether that's a cultivar name or just a misspelling of "Thai." Is there any chance that this banana is Kluai Hom Thong, Gros Michel, the banana that they used to sell in the US until the 1950s? If not, what kind is it?

Not Gros Michel. Looks like a Bluggo type. Those green ones on the upper left are something else, Saba perhaps?
